Description

  • Sir Thomas Lawrence P.R.A.
  • Portait of Lady Georgina North (died 1835), Unfinished
  • bust-length, wearing a white dress
  • oil on canvas

Provenance

Lord North, Wroxton Abbey, Banbury;
From whom purchased by 'Temple' in 1907;
With Thos. Agnew & Sons, London;
Mr. Eugene Cremetti, London;
With James Connell & Sons, London;
With Scott & Fowles, New York:
Mrs. Stevenson Scott, New York, by 1955;
With Newhouse Galleries, Inc., New York;
From whom purchased by a member of the present family on October 12, 1972.

Literature

K. Garlick, Sir Thomas Lawrence, Boston, 1955, p. 52;
K. Garlick, ed., A Catalogue of the Paintings, Drawings and Pastels of Sir Thomas Lawrence, The Walpole Society, vol. 39, Glasgow 1964, p. 152;
K. Garlick, Sir Thomas Lawrence, a complete catalogue of the oil paintings, Oxford 1989,  p. 246, cat. no. 609 (b), illustrated.

Catalogue Note

Lady Georgina sat for Lawrence on three different occassions.  The first, circa 1806-07, was for a portrait with her sister, Susan, later Baroness North (location unknown).  The second, circa 1812, was for a double portrait with her mother Susan, Countess of Guilford (J.B. Speed Art Museum, Louisville, Kentucky).  The last time Lady Georgina sat for Lawrence, in 1828, was for the present portrait.

Lady Georgina was the third daughter of the 3rd Earl of Gilford.  She died unmarried.
